Certified Nursing Assistant
Location: Milford, DE
Start Date: 08-28-2026
Contract Type: Per-Diem
Shift Type: Per Diem, 3:00 PM - 11:00 PM (Evening Shift)
Candidate Pay Rate: $17 per hour

Roles & Responsibilities
- Provide direct patient care including assistance with daily living activities
- Monitor and report changes in patient condition to the nursing team
- Assist with mobility, transfers, and positioning for comfort and safety
- Document care provided accurately and timely
- Maintain a clean, safe, and welcoming environment for residents
Qualifications
- Active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ification in Delaware
- Current BLS certification from the American Heart Association
- Ability to pass a background check and drug screen
- COVID-19 vaccination or approved exemption
- Previous experience in a long-term care or skilled nursing setting preferred
Knowledge & Skills
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
- Compassionate and patient-centered approach to care
- Ability to work effectively as part of a multidisciplinary team
- Knowledge of basic medical terminology and infection control practices
- Time management and organizational skills
